Rosie’s Burgers is a family-owned local favourite in the trendy Queen West neighbourhood of Toronto since 2021. Dedicated to the classics, we’re passionate about serving up the nostalgic flavours you know, love, and crave. From our smashburgers and fries to strawberry shakes and onion rings, we’re all about keeping things simple and perfecting tradition. Swing by for a quick bite, stick around for the good vibes.

After seeing this burger shop trending all over social media for months, I finally decided to give it a try. I was nothing short of amazed with the quality and taste of the food. I tried the Rosie Burger, fries, and banana pudding.

The patty on the burger was crispy and flavourful, and a single patty was the perfect amount of meat for me. There were lots of veggies in the burger as well, that were fresh and tasty. Moreover, we were shocked by how good the fries tasted — far better than waffle fries from Shake Shack, and close to those from Daves Hot Chicken. This is mainly because they were well seasoned, thick, and very crispy on the outside while being mushy (like mashed potatoes) on the inside. I would honestly come back just for their fries and banana pudding, which I will discuss next. The banana pudding received so much hype on the internet and I think it is deserved. The creamy custard-like pudding is perfectly sweet and cold, and the slices of banana are perfectly creamy against the chew of the crumble on top. It was the perfect dessert after the exceptional burger and fries.

All in all, Rosie’s Burgers deserves all of its hype and I would absolutely come back or try other locations in the city. I believe they will be extremely successful in the long run, and it’s well earned! I highly recommend this burger spot to anyone looking to try new burger joints.
